Subject: DR Drill — Restockly Planner, Plugin Authors Please Read

Hello plugin authors,

Next Thursday we will run a disaster-recovery drill on the Restockly planner sandbox. Your plugins may see brief API outages while we restore from cold backup. If you need to re-attach to the sandbox afterward, the restore console will request the drill recovery passphrase, which is:

vault phrase of fawif-haduf = wenwyn-briath

### Ticket: Expired credential blocks Vaultspin plugin sync

Plugin authors reported that Vaultspin's rotation utility began rejecting sync requests after last week's scheduled rollover. The previous credential expired without the grace window we documented; we apologize for the disruption. A replacement has been issued and validated against the staging rotator. Please update your plugin configuration with the key below.

app token of bahaf-tajeg = zpat23_SjjsllwiLmXbtS65veZaV47

# Expansion: Korvane Basin Region (Managers Only)

Marrowfield Logistics will open three depots across the Korvane Basin next fiscal year. Branch managers should review staffing transfers, local licensing timelines, and the phased rollout of the Lendrix routing system before committing resources. Treat all projections as provisional. The confidential planning note appended below sets out the underlying business rationale.

management briefing: The board signed off on a budget of $30.3 million for Project Fraion. The renewal with Belvanox Freight closes at $15.8 million a year, 45 percent above the last contract.

// LintScribe doc linter — constants below control severity and scan scope.
// Support: most "linter is broken" tickets are actually threshold trips.
// Rules fire per-file; whole-repo scans are throttled to avoid CI stalls.
// Do not hand-edit these in prod; changes ship through the Varnholt config
// pipeline. When triaging, compare the reported values against the table
// of constants that follows.

tuning constants:
QUOTAS = {
    "druwyn": 5,
    "holix": 5,
    "zorath": 5,
    "holwyn": 10,
}